Why Do I See Two Salary Ranges?The City of Greeley, in compliance with Colorado state law, includes a salary range for all positions posted. This law improves wage transparency. We post both the full salary range and the anticipated hiring range, where we expect to make an offer. Offers are based on experience, education, certifications, and other factors.

Job SummaryThe City of Greeley Water & Sewer Department is seeking four seasonal laborers interested in learning the Water operations of a treatment plant and providing maintenance to the facility operations during the operational season May - October 2026. This is an entry level “operator in training” opportunity to learn and grow your career with the City of Greeley, located at the Boyd Water Treatment Plant in Loveland , Colorado.
The successful incumbent will be a professional who is committed to assisting the Boyd Water Treatment Plant with providing water for a growing, dynamic community. As a part of the Boyd Water Treatment Division, you will work with a group of committed employees, and other professionals who are dedicated to continuing and enhancing Greeley's leadership role in the Colorado water community.
If you are innovative, enjoy challenges and are seeking an entry level position with significant responsibility and opportunity for advancement, come see what Boyd has to offer.
These positions will work approximately May 7 – October 8, 2026.
